Bulgaria - Consumer confidence indicator was -27.00% in February of 2023, according to the EUROSTAT. Trading Economics provides the current actual value, an historical data chart and related indicators for Bulgaria - Consumer confidence indicator - last updated from the EUROSTAT on March of 2023. Historically, Bulgaria - Consumer confidence indicator reached a record high of -19.20% in January of 2022 and a record low of -32.50% in May of 2022.
